Pro stress-test →Patterson-UTI Energy provides land-based drilling services to major and independent oil and natural gas companies, conducting drilling operations in Texas, New Mexico, Utah, Oklahoma, Louisiana, and western Canada. The company operates through three segments: Drilling Services, Completion Services, and Drilling Products.
Strategic Profile
Pro stress-test →Patterson-UTI offers integrated onshore oil and gas services with a diversified operation portfolio. The company positions itself as a comprehensive provider of well services including contract drilling, pressure pumping, directional drilling, and specialized drill bit solutions across North America's major producing basins.
Competitive Landscape
Pro stress-test →Patterson-UTI competes in the onshore contract drilling and oilfield services market alongside Helmerich & Payne, Nabors Industries, and RPC Inc. Its integrated service model spanning drilling, completion, and drilling products provides a differentiated position versus pure-play drilling contractors.
